Did the expression "Who Dey?" really originate in Cincinnati.

While the chant "Who Dey" has been used for over 30 years in support of the Cincinnati Bengals, the term may actually stem from a similar chant used by New Orleans Saints fans: "Who Dat." The full chant is "Who dat talkin' 'bout beatin' dem Jags." Similarly, the full version of the Bengals chant goes "Who dey think gonna beat dem Bengals?" This has spurred a long-standing debate between Saints and Bengals fans about where the chant actually originated.
